Building a Scalable Network by Daisy-Chaining PoE Switches

How many PoE switches can I daisy-chain together? Limiting daisy-chaining to three or four switches is generally recommended to avoid power distribution issues and bandwidth bottlenecks.

How many devices can a PoE switch support?

A PoE switch can support as many devices as it has PoE-enabled ports, but the actual number of supported devices will be limited by the switch''s total power budget and the power consumption of
